- Kaip rankiniu būdu skaidyti standųjį diską iš komandinės eilutės

Kaip rankiniu būdu skaidyti standųjį diską iš komandinės eilutės "Linux"

Norite rankiniu būdu suskaidyti standųjį diską anksčiaudiegti mėgstamą „Linux“ paskirstymą? Jei taip, apsvarstykite galimybę tai padaryti komandinėje eilutėje. Tai nėra taip nuobodu, kaip jūs manote. Tiesą sakant, rankiniu būdu standžiojo disko skaidymas terminale yra daug greitesnis, efektyvesnis ir leidžia žymiai greičiau įdiegti jūsų OS.

Be to, kad terminalo metodas yra greitesnis, jis taip pat išmokys jus daug daugiau apie tai, kaip skaidiniai veikia „Linux“.

Štai kodėl šiame vadove mes apžvelgsime, kaip rankiniu būdu skaidyti standųjį diską iš „Linux“ komandinės eilutės, naudodami „GNU Parted“.

UFEI

Tai yra instrukcijos, kaip rankiniu būdu skaidyti standųjį diską, naudojant UEFI / saugią įkrovą.

Viena šaknis

„Vienos šaknies“ sąranka reiškia, kad visi jūsų „Linux“ diegimo duomenys yra viename skaidinyje. Nėra atskiro /namai, / var ar nieko panašaus. Ši sąranka yra gera naujiems vartotojams, kurie tik pradeda naudotis rankiniu skaidinių sąranka ir nesupranta, kaip (ar kodėl) atskiri prijungimo taškai sąveikauja su sistema.

Tiesioginis būdas greitai suskaidyti sunkųjį įrenginįdiskas „Linux“ yra su atskirtu įrankiu. Nėra painios terminalo grafinės sąsajos, kurią naudoti. Vietoj to, vartotojams tereikia įvesti skaidinių dydžius, o vėliau juos formatuoti.

Norėdami nustatyti UEFI, atlikite šiuos veiksmus. Pirmiausia atidarykite terminalą ir paleiskite lsblk. Ši komanda išvardins visus blokuojamus įrenginius. Naudokite tai norėdami rasti savo disko etiketę. Tada paimk vardą ir daryk:

Pastaba: pakeiskite X raide lsblk rodo.

sudo parted /dev/sdX

Norint nustatyti UEFI, standžiojo disko lentelė turi būti GPT. Naudodami išskaidytą įrankį, standžiajame diske sukurkite GPT skaidinių lentelę.

mklabel gpt

Kitas UEFI proceso veiksmas yra sukurti atskirą įkrovos skaidinį.

mkpart ESP fat32 1MiB 513MiB

Jei jums reikia apsikeitimo skaidinio jūsų UEFIsistemą, padarykite vieną naudodamiesi dalimis. Atminkite, kad jis turėtų būti maždaug tokio pat dydžio kaip jūsų RAM (2 GB įrenginyje turėtų būti 2 GB mainai ir pan.). Nepaisant to, jei turite 8 GB ar daugiau RAM, apsvarstykite galimybę nedaryti didesnio kaip 4 GB skaidinio.

mkpart primary linux-swap 513MiB 4GiB

Su / bagažinė ir pakeiskite kelią iš naujo, paskutinis dalykas, kurį liko atlikti rankinio skaidinio sąrankoje, yra sukurti / šaknis pertvara. Šis skaidinys talpins beveik viską jūsų kompiuteryje, todėl jam reikės likusio kietojo disko.

mkpart primary ext4 4GiB 100%

Įveskite mesti į raginimą išeiti. Būtent šiuo metu mes galime naudoti komandą mkfs, kad suformatuotume visas failų sistemas, kad vėliau jas būtų galima naudoti bet kuriame „Linux“ paskirstymo diegimo programoje. Šiame pavyzdyje kaip disko etiketę naudosime / dev / sda. Jūsų gali skirtis.

mkfs.vfat -F32 /dev/sda1
mkfs.ext4 -f /dev/sda3

Padalinti namus

Norite padalinti namus, skirtus jūsų UEFI sąrankai? Jei taip, vykdykite visas aukščiau pateiktas instrukcijas, kol pateksite į / root dalį. Nepaisykite aukščiau esančių žingsnių ir atlikite šiuos veiksmus:

Šiame pavyzdyje kietasis diskas yra 500 GB. Atminkite, kad jūsų pajėgumas gali būti skirtingas, ir jums reikės atitinkamai pakeisti komandas.

Pastaba: nors diskas yra 500 GB, naudojamas 4 GB + 512 MB. Tai mums palieka maždaug 495 GB. Atlikdami šį kitą veiksmą, „root“ skaidiniui suteiksime 100 GB, nes „/ home“ skaidinio dydis visuomet turėtų būti reikšmingesnis šiai sąrankai.

mkpart primary ext4 4GiB 104GiB

Su / šaknis Pasiskirstymas naudojant 100 GB kietojo disko, mums liko apie 395 GB paraiškos dėl /namai pertvara. Šios paskutinės dalies numeriai neturi būti tikslūs. Vietoj to, mes galime liepti išsiskirsčiusiems užpildyti likusią disko dalį.

mkpart primary ext4 104GiB 100%

Visos pertvaros yra nustatytos, todėl gerai, jei norite išeiti iš „Parted“ įrankio. Naudokite mesti išeiti iš programos. Tada suformatuokite naujus skaidinius naudodami mkfs viską baigti.

sudo mkfs.vfat -F32 /dev/sda1
sudo mkfs.ext4 -f /dev/sda3
sudo mkfs.ext4 -f /dev/sda4

BIOS

Atidarykite savo diską atskirtiniame įrankyje:

sudo parted /dev/sdX

Viduje „Parted“ sukurkite MS-DOS skaidinių lentelę.

mklabel msdos

Vienvietis šaknis

Pagal šį išdėstymą pirmiausia turėtų būti keičiamasi sukeitimu. Naudodami „Parted“, sukurkite naują mainų skaidinį. Apkeitimo pertvaros visada turėtų būti tokio pat dydžio kaip jūsų RAM. Tačiau jei turite 8 GB, 16 GB ar daugiau, apsvarstykite galimybę naudoti 4. Turėti 32 GB mainų skaidinį yra labai sudėtinga.

mkpart primary linux-swap 1MiB 4GiB

Norėdami baigti savo vienos šaknies išdėstymą, nurodykite įrankiui „Parted“, kad likusį kietąjį diską naudosite šiam paskutiniam skaidiniui.

mkpart primary ext4 4GiB 100%

Iš čia įveskite mesti išeiti iš „Parted“ įrankio ir naudoti mkfs suformatuoti naujai sukurtus skaidinius, kad „Linux“ operacinės sistemos diegimo įrankiai galėtų juos tinkamai skaityti.

sudo mkfs.ext4 -f /dev/sda2

Padalinti namus

Norėdami nustatyti namų padalijimą, vykdykite šias instrukcijas. Pirmiausia sukurkite savo MS-DOS skaidinių lentelę.

mklabel msdos

Sukurkite keičiamąjį skaidinį, kurį sistema naudotų:

mkpart primary linux-swap 1MiB 4GiB

Atlikdami šį žingsnį, mes taip padalijame standųjį diskąkad šakninis skaidinys turi 100 GB vietos, o namų skaidinys turi likusią dalį. Pavyzdžiui, mūsų diskas turi 500 GB. Jūsų gali skirtis. Sukurkite šakninį skaidinį „Parted“ ir nurodykite įrankiui, kad jam būtų skirta 100 GB vietos.

mkpart primary ext4 4GiB 104GiB

Padarykite savo namų pertvarą naudodami „100%“, kad ji sunaudotų likusią laisvą vietą.

mkpart primary ext4 104GiB 100%

Uždarykite atskirtą įrankį naudodami mesti ir tada naudok mkfs suformatuoti naujus skaidinius.

sudo mkfs.ext4 -F /dev/sda2
sudo mkfs.ext4 -F /dev/sda3
</p>

Komentarai